Patriotic Party Mix

This was super cute for our Olympic viewing party :)  Easy to make!!


Ingredients

  • 4 cups Chex cereal
  • 3 cups Cheerios
  • 2 cups pretzels snaps
  • 11/2 cups dry roasted peanuts
  • 1 (16 ounce) package candiquik candy coating or 1 (20 ounce) package vanilla almond bark
  • 2 (1.7 ounce) containers red, white and blue sprinkles
  • 1 cup regular red, white and blue M&M’s
  • 1 cup peanut red, white and blue M&M’s

  1. In a large bowl, combine the Chex cereal, Cheerios, pretzels and peanuts.
  2. In a microwave safe bowl, melt the almond bark or candy coating according to package directions, usually 2 minutes, stirring every 30 seconds until melted and smooth. Be sure not to over melt the almond bark as it will burn and become too thick to stir and coat the mix evenly.
  3. Pour the melted almond bark over the ingredients in the large bowl and toss to coat with a large spoon. Ingredients should be evenly coated in the almond bark.
  4. Spread the mixture out in an even layer on parchment paper. Immediately sprinkle with the sprinkles and then the M&M’s. Allow mixture to cool completely. Break apart to serve. Store in an airtight container or baggie.

Patriotic Punch

Ok so I tried to find something fun and easy to bring to our 4th of July celebration.....and it was fun....and easy - but it didn't turn out :)

Here is what my drink looked like:

and here is what it was supposed to look like:

So yeah....I tried.  It still tasted very sugary and awesome :)  Just didn't look as pretty....if you try it and it works, let me know :)

Ingredients:
Hawaiian Punch (red color)
Diet Sierra mist (white color - also works for you preggers out there!)
G2 Gatorade (blue color)

Then all you do is fill your glass all the way to to the top with ice.  Start with red (or whichever has the highest sugar content) - and fill up the glass 1/3 of the way.  When you pour your next two layers pour them slowly, right over and ice cube, down the side of the glass.  (this part didn't work for me....mine just blended as soon as I poured.  I tried like 4 glasses too...)
